From the scene http://www.***********..com/pacquiaos-blood-test-24-days-hatton-bout--24398 ***********.com has received a copy of document outlining Manny Pacquiao's blood test; taken for his May 2 fight with Ricky Hatton. The blood test was taken by Dr. Richard Gluckman and sent to Quest Diagnostics on April 8, 2009, which is 24-days before the fight with Hatton. The latest discovery punches holes in some of the stories that claim Pacquiao took a blood test "14-days" before the Hatton fight. The footage of the blood test [Pacquiao/Hatton 24/7] may have aired 14-days before the fight, but actual test was taken on April 8." from ESPN http://sports.espn.go.com/sports/boxing/news/story?id=4777048 "The blood test was conducted 24 days before the fight" ****ing douchebag
